The price of Chanel escarpins varies significantly depending on several factors:
* Material: The material used in the construction of the shoe greatly influences the price. Genuine leather, particularly lambskin or calfskin, commands a higher price than other materials. Exotic leathers, such as snakeskin or crocodile, will significantly increase the cost.
* Style: Classic styles, like the iconic slingback, often hold their value and may command a higher price than more contemporary designs. Limited-edition or collaborative releases also tend to be more expensive.
* Details: Intricate details, such as embellishments, embroidery, or unique hardware, add to the overall cost. Shoes featuring metallic accents, crystals, or pearls will be priced higher than simpler designs.
* Condition: The condition of the shoe is crucial, especially when purchasing pre-owned pieces. Mint-condition shoes will command a higher price than those showing signs of wear.
Exploring the Range: From Classic Escarpins to Chic Espadrilles
The Chanel footwear collection boasts a diverse range of styles, catering to various tastes and preferences. Let's explore some of the most popular categories:
1. Escarpin Chanel Femme: This encompasses the classic Chanel pump, often featuring a pointed toe and a mid-to-high heel. These are versatile pieces that can be dressed up or down, making them a staple in any discerning woman's wardrobe. Prices for these classic styles can range from several hundred to several thousand dollars, depending on the factors mentioned above.
